What does a geospatial engineer do?

A geospatial engineer analyzes and interprets geographic data using GIS (Geographic Information Systems), remote sensing, and mapping tools. They develop spatial models, create maps, and support projects related to land use, environmental management, or infrastructure planning, often working with GPS technology and spatial databases.

What Is a Geospatial Engineer?

A geospatial engineer uses modern mapping technologies, such as GIS and GPS, to map, collect, and analyze geographic data. They work with mapping or visualization tools to create 2D or 3D maps of building sites, national parks, or other locations of interest. Geospatial engineers also locate archeological sites or potential sites for civil engineering projects, such as dams or bridges. To pursue a career as a geospatial engineer, you need a bachelor’s degree in engineering, geography, geographic information systems, or a related field. Other qualifications include proficiency in mapping software, strong data analysis skills, and job experience in the industry.

What is the difference between Geospatial Engineer vs GIS Analyst?

AspectGeospatial EngineerGIS Analyst
Required CredentialsBachelor's in Geospatial Science, GIS, or related field; certifications like GISPBachelor's in Geography, GIS, or related; certifications like GISP
Work EnvironmentFieldwork, data collection, GIS software developmentData analysis, map creation, spatial data management
Employer & IndustryEngineering firms, government agencies, tech companiesGovernment agencies, urban planning, environmental organizations
Common Search & ComparisonYesYes

While both Geospatial Engineers and GIS Analysts work with spatial data, Geospatial Engineers focus more on developing GIS systems, managing data infrastructure, and integrating geospatial technology into engineering projects. GIS Analysts primarily analyze spatial data, create maps, and support decision-making through data visualization. Both roles require similar credentials and often collaborate, but their core responsibilities differ in scope and application.

About SparkPNT

SparkPNT, a subsidiary of SparkFun Electronics, is dedicated to advancing Positioning, Navigation, and Timing (PNT) technology. Since developing our first high-precision surveyor in 2020, SparkPNT has been on a mission to make cutting-edge PNT solutions accessible for precision applications. Our product line includes a range of surveying devices, reference stations, and timing solutions designed to deliver centimeter-level accuracy.
